Chapter 52: Asking Bai Mu Mu to Return the Access Jade Token
Wen Xuan gave a soft reply and said: “Mm. It also counts as going to check on Junior Sister.”
Back in front of the Library Pavilion, Luo Chu had said that Shen Sang Ruo still held a grudge because he gave the access jade token to Bai Mu Mu, and he even said he would hand over his own token to her. That talk reminded Wen Xuan of the truth.
The access jade token was Shen Sang Ruo’s in the first place. He had been muddled when he took it back, then he gave it to Bai Mu Mu.
So he did not need to look for materials or change the Restriction Formation at all.
He only needed to take the access jade token that belonged to Shen Sang Ruo back from Bai Mu Mu.
As for Bai Mu Mu, she spent the most time with him. Whenever she went to his cave dwelling, they traveled together, so she almost never needed that token.
Even Luo Chu, who could not stand Shen Sang Ruo, was willing to give her his own access jade token. Bai Mu Mu was kind by nature, so for the sake of harmony in the sect, she would surely bring the token out too.
Both in feeling and in reason, asking Bai Mu Mu to return the token was the best choice.
Wen Xuan lowered his voice and murmured: “Junior Sister is so sensible. If I explain it, she should understand.”
Luo Chu frowned and asked: “Second Senior Brother, what are you muttering about?”
Wen Xuan steadied his gaze and said: “Nothing. Let’s go.”
He had made up his mind, and his steps no longer felt so heavy. [Junior Sister will definitely agree.]
Bai Mu Mu, her face pale and her eyes brimming with tears, said: “It’s okay, Second Senior Brother. You can take back the access jade token.”
She added with a trembling voice: “This access jade token was Fifth Senior Sister’s from the start. I took what belonged to her. I should return it.”
She looked at Wen Xuan and said: “Like you said before, Mumu only came back two years ago. Of course I can’t compare to the deep bonds between the senior brothers and Fifth Senior Sister. It’s right that you care more about Fifth Senior Sister.”
Wen Xuan tried to explain and said: “That’s not what I meant…”
But Bai Mu Mu’s soft sobs kept him from getting a word in.
She lowered her lashes and said: “It’s fine if I’m the only one in our sect without an access jade token. Mumu has long since gotten used to it.”
The words made people picture the unfair treatment she must have faced before she returned to the sect, to the point she would say she was “used to it.”
She whispered, cherishing each word: “Every gift from the senior brothers is precious to me. I already treated that access jade token like a treasure.”
She bowed her head and said: “Now I have to give it back to Fifth Senior Sister. My heart hurts so much that I lost my composure. Please forgive me, Second Senior Brother, Fourth Senior Brother.”
Bai Mu Mu dabbed at the corners of her eyes, trying to calm herself, but tears slipped free like beads from a broken string.
She truly looked heartbroken.
Wen Xuan had never expected Bai Mu Mu to react like this. Seeing her so weak, with tears tracing down her cheeks, he felt at a loss.
Her eyes red, she stayed silent and began feeling through her storage pouch for the access jade token.
Large teardrops splashed onto the pouch, soaking a patch.
It was the look of someone who had found warmth again only to be abandoned once more, the hurt and brokenness shown clear as day.
Luo Chu could not watch anymore. He glared at Wen Xuan and said: “I thought you came out of kindness to see Junior Sister, but you’re really here for Shen Sang Ruo, to take back Junior Sister’s access jade token.”
He pressed on angrily and said: “Junior Sister is still badly injured. How could you be so hard-hearted and say this to her now?”
Bai Mu Mu tugged weakly at his sleeve and said: “Fourth Senior Brother, don’t blame Second Senior Brother. It’s me. I’m just not worthy.”
Her hopeless tone made Luo Chu’s heart ache even more. Look at what they had done to Junior Sister—she was saying she was not worthy.
He turned to her and said with firm warmth: “You are worthy! You are Sect Master Shen’s own daughter, Master Ling Xiao’s Personal Disciple, and our true Junior Sister. You deserve the best of everything in the world!”
Bai Mu Mu looked at him through tears, as if asking whether it was really true.
Luo Chu faced Wen Xuan and said: “Second Senior Brother, this is between you and Shen Sang Ruo. What does it have to do with Junior Sister? Why come at her?”
He spoke faster and said: “You gave the access jade token when you felt like it, and now you’re taking it back when you feel like it. What is that supposed to be? Junior Sister did nothing, yet you drag her in for no reason.”
His eyes burned as he asked: “What do you take Junior Sister for? A tool to store your access jade token, to summon and dismiss as you please?”
Bai Mu Mu tugged at him again and whispered: “Enough, Fourth Senior Brother, please don’t say more.”
Of course it had no effect.
Her pull was like a thin leash thrown over a fierce dog. Instead of quieting, Luo Chu barked even louder.
He jabbed a finger at Wen Xuan and said: “You were the one who told me that people must take responsibility for what they do.”
That was what Wen Xuan had told him when he had made a mess before. Wen Xuan had told Bai Mu Mu to keep the things he had given her, and made Luo Chu repay the Spirit Stones himself.
Luo Chu grimaced and said: “I still owe a mountain of debt because of that.”
He took a breath and said: “Now this is your mess. You should figure out a way to solve it. Why push everything onto Junior Sister and make her help you?”
He ended sharply and said: “In short, you cannot set your sights on Junior Sister’s access jade token.”
Wen Xuan’s heart was a tangled knot.
He had no way to refute Luo Chu’s words, and looking at Bai Mu Mu’s state, he truly could not bear it.
But the access jade token belonged to Shen Sang Ruo.
If it stayed in Bai Mu Mu’s hands, then what about Shen Sang Ruo?
Should someone take what was rightfully hers?
He had also promised Shen Sang Ruo that he would put her access jade token back into her hands.
Seeing Wen Xuan silent for a long time, with his brows drawn tight, Luo Chu said again: “I really don’t know what you’re struggling over.”
He huffed and said: “I already told you to give my access jade token to Shen Sang Ruo. You refused, and you just had to come snatch Junior Sister’s, didn’t you?”
He glanced at Bai Mu Mu and said: “Pitiful Junior Sister can’t even sit up yet, and she still has to go through this.”
He clicked his tongue and said: “Everyone says sick people must not have big mood swings. Second Senior Brother, you’re a healer, yet you have no sense.”
He shook his head and said: “I truly don’t understand. Junior Sister has so little. Shen Sang Ruo has everything. Why do you have to hold on to Junior Sister and not let go?”
Wen Xuan corrected him and said: “This access jade token was Little Ruo’s from the start. It’s not snatching, and it’s not that Little Ruo wants to snatch.”
He was not even sure whether Shen Sang Ruo would accept the access jade token.
But he still clung to it as a stubborn belief, as if by holding on to this belief he could keep Shen Sang Ruo. [If I can put that token in her hand again, maybe I can keep her by my side.]
Luo Chu threw up his hands and said: “Fine, fine, it’s not snatching. Then do what I said and give my access jade token to Shen Sang Ruo.”
Wen Xuan showed a bitter smile and said: “It’s not the same. It’s not the same…”
It would not be the token he first gave Shen Sang Ruo, and it could not heal the rift between them.
